Regulation of retinal autoimmunity via the idiotypic network |

The immune response to self antigens is regulated through an interplay of idiotypes and anti-idiotypes expressed on antibodies and lymphoid cells. The equilibrium of the different components of the immune system has been modulated in various autoimmune diseases by manipulation of the idiotypic network. Experimental autoimmune uveoretinitis (EAU) was induced in rats with one foot pad injection of S-antigen (S-Ag) in complete Freund's adjuvant (CFA). 1. Injection of rats with the mouse anti-S-Ag monoclonal antibody (mAb) S2D2 either simultaneously with or before S-Ag challenge, led to an anti-idiotypic (anti-Id) response and to inhibition of EAU. 2. Suppression of the disease could be passively transferred using lymph node and/or spleen cells from donors immunized with S2D2 to naive recipients, prior to immunization with bovine S-Ag in CFA. In contrast, one injection of IgG from S2D2-immunized rats did not prevent EAU. 3. Preimmunization against a purified rat polyclonal anti-Id-S2D2 antibody (internal image of the epitope recognized by mAb S2D2) before S-Ag challenge also allowed to inhibit EAU. As S2D2 was the best of several anti-S-Ag mAbs tested for disease inhibition, the epitope recognized by S2D2 should be of particular interest in the regulation of the immune response. This epitope has been localized to the N-terminal region of S-Ag, in the amino acid sequence 40–50. The S2D2 epitope is distant from all presently known uveitogenic sites. Manipulation of the idiotypic network for selected epitopes of the autoantigen may provide a valuable approach to therapy of autoimmune disease.

Manipulation of the immune response by monoclonal antibodies in auto-immune pathology |

Murine monoclonal antibodies have proven to be invaluable tools in medical research and diagnosis. However, their use as therapeutic agents remains limited since these proteins can act as foreign antigens in the human host. An immune response subsequent to administration of monoclonal antibodies may result in unpredictable in vivo distribution and insufficient interaction with cellular or molecular targets of the immune system. Also, the patient may produce anti-anti-bodies that can neutralize the effects of the therapeutically administered monoclonal antibodies. Treatment of autoimmune disease is an important potential therapeutic application of monoclonal antibodies, provided that these difficulties can be overcome.

Cytokines and intraocular inflammation |

Although new endogenous mediators of inflammatory and immune responses are reported almost on a monthly basis, the cytokines IL-1, TNF, and IL-6 have emerged as the primary regulators of local inflammation in man.In this paper, uveitogenic and other properties of these particular cytokines are discussed and attention is payed to the possible involvement of a cytokine-network in the development of uveitis.

HLA-B27 and acute anterior uveitis |

This article reviews the ophthalmological significance of the association between HLA-B27 and acute anterior uveitis (AAU). HLA-B27 determination should be performed in all cases of acute anterior uveitis (AAU), since B27+AAU is a distinct kind of uveitis. All B27+AAU patients have to be referred to a rheumatologist because half of these patients has ankylosing spondylitis or Reiter's syndrome. The structure and physiological role of HLA-class I molecules is now known. It is probable that the role of HLA-B27 in the pathogenesis of AAU will be revealed in the coming years.
